일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| |
7 | 8 | 9 | 10 | 11 | 12 | 13 |
14 | 15 | 16 | 17 | 18 | 19 | 20 |
21 | 22 | 23 | 24 | 25 | 26 | 27 |
28 | 29 | 30 | 31 |
Tags
- Substring with Concatenation of All Words
- data science
- attribute
- 밴픽
- Convert Sorted List to Binary Search Tree
- 프로그래머스
- LeetCode
- Regular Expression
- kaggle
- Decorator
- 715. Range Module
- Python Code
- t1
- 운영체제
- iterator
- Python Implementation
- 파이썬
- 시바견
- concurrency
- 109. Convert Sorted List to Binary Search Tree
- Generator
- Protocol
- DWG
- Python
- 315. Count of Smaller Numbers After Self
- 컴퓨터의 구조
- Class
- shiba
- 30. Substring with Concatenation of All Words
- 43. Multiply Strings
Archives
- Today
- Total
목록디스크 컨트롤러 (1)
Scribbling
프로그래머스: 디스크 컨트롤러
Priority Queue를 이용하면 쉽게 풀 수 있다. 알고리즘은 '대기 큐에 들어온 Task 중 수행 시간이 가장 짧은 Task를 먼저 처리한다'가 답이다. 이는 운영체제 CPU 스케줄링 방식 중 하나인 SJF (Shortest Job First)와 유사하다. SJF가 궁금하다면, https://focalpoint.tistory.com/96?category=918151 쉽게 배우는 운영체제 내용 정리 - Chapter 04 CPU 스케줄링 1. 스케줄링 CPU 스케줄링은 CPU에 어떤 작업을 배정할지 결정하는 것이다. 컴퓨터 시스템의 효율은 이에 따라 달라진다. 앞서 배운 것 처럼, 프로세스는 생성 상태, 준비 상태, 실행 상태, 대기 상 focalpoint.tistory.com import heap..
Computer Science/Coding Test
2021. 10. 16. 16:44